Las Vegas - Sahara

John Kunkle
John is the newest member of the Las Vegas IAE faculty. He grew up in Ohio, taught there and received his B.A. in English and French from Heidelberg College and his M.A. in Romance Languages from Case Western Reserve University. He then taught in the Wisconsin University system and received his Ph.D. in Second Language Education. Moving to the University of Louisiana, he directed a 2000-student ESL program and was heavily involved with the French-English bilingual programs there, and published some 20 books, articles and papers. In 1980, he and his family moved to Saudi Arabia, where he worked for the world's largest oil-producing company, teaching ESL, French and opera appreciation (!) in the evenings. John came to Las Vegas in 1997, working first as an educational consultant to the Weapons School at Nellis Air Force Base, and then five years with FLS, while also teaching French and ESL to performers and staff at  Mystère and Ka, and ESL to employees in casinos in Las Vegas and Primm. He currently also teaches at the Community Multicultural Center. John has sung with and directed several choral groups, and in 2004, went on a singing tour of European cathedrals with one of them. He is an avid swimmer and occasionally teaches swimming and diving.  John enjoys Las Vegas and IAE, but also likes to visit his five grandchildren in Florida.
  

Loretta Dutt
 
 Loretta earned her Master of Arts Degree in Teaching English to Speakers of Other Languages from the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ign in 1995. She has taught ESL at the intensive English institutes at the University of Illinois and Ohio University and EFL in Madrid, Spain. She enjoys using the internet to teach and tutor students, which she first did as a reading/writing tutor for native speakers at the St. Louis Community College, and in other ways helping language learners reach their goals. Loretta lives in Las Vegas with her wonderful husband, Timothy, and their "sweetest dog in the world," Belen.
  

Arlene Tedesco
Arlene received her B.A. in Science at Johnson and Wales University in Rhode Island and went on to earn a TEFL/TESL certificate from Transworld Teachers in California. She started teaching ESL with the Literacy Volunteers of America in Boston, Massachusetts, before going to Florence, Italy and teaching ESL in private language school and companies for seven years.  She frequented the University of Florence and received a proficiency certificate in the Italian language.  Recently she has taught through the University of Las Vegas as well as The College of Southern Nevada. Arlene has been teaching ESL at the International Academy of English since 2001.  her hobbies and interests include cooking, eating out, and going to shows, as well as being a world traveler.  She speaks Spanish and Italian and is currently a trustee with the Sons of Italy organization in Las Vegas.
  

Linda Tannenbaum
Linda has been an educator for the past eighteen years.  After graduating from college in Pennsylvania with a B.A. in Psychology, she returned to New York and began her career as a teacher for the New York City School System.  Linda worked as an instructor of English Language Learners and Special Education children for ten years and during that time she completed a Masters Degree in education at the City University of New York.  Linda relocated to California with her husband and two children and worked in California as an instructor and an administrator while completing a second Masters in Educational Leadership.  In 2005 she moved to Las Vegas with her family and began working for IAE.  Linda has a great deal of experience and training in literacy and has worked with Foreign Language Students at all levels.  In her spare time she enjoys gardening, traveling with her family, and exploring all that the Las Vegas environment has to offer!
  

Marisa Suescun

For the past nine years, Marisa Suescun has dedicated her professional life to public education, having begun her career as a member of the first cohort of the NYC Teaching Fellows. Her impressive background includes working for the NYC Teaching Fellows, teaching SAT preparation in Brooklyn, and instructing ESL classes in Ecuador. Most recently, Marisa served as Assistant Director of the Exploring Leadership program at the Coro New York Leadership Center. In addition to her work within the field of education, Marisa has published dozens of articles and reviews in several publications.

Currently, Marisa teaches intermediate-level grammar and conversation, and serves on the Founders Group and Curriculum Committee of Active Minds Institute, an organization set to open a public charter school in Saint Louis in September 2010.

Marisa holds a Bachelors degree in American Studies from Wesleyan University, and a Masters in Education from City College of New York.

  

Debra Jablonski
Debra has been teaching ESL for the past two years. After graduating from Stony Brook University in 2001, she taught Global History and Sociology at a Long Island high school. With a strong desire to experience life in a different place, she ventured to Santiago, Chile in 2007. There, she taught English as a volunteer through Harvard University's World Teach DuocUC program. Debra has been with the academy since February of 2008. She currently leads upper-intermediate grammar and conversation classes, as well as a special elective class for phrasal verbs and idioms. She enjoys the challenge of
developing innovative, fun ways to help her students internalize proper written and spoken grammar. Her inspiration in life and teaching is derived from sunshine, her husband and, of course, her terrific students!
